A single error in your PCB footprint can bring your entire assembly process to a halt. Incorrect pad sizes, misaligned components, or missing solder mask definitions lead to manufacturing defects, costly reworks, and frustrating project delays.

Here are 5 practical rules to ensure your footprints are perfect for manufacturing.

1. Trust, but Verify the Datasheet
The component datasheet is your starting point, but it's not always perfect.
Find the "PCBA" Section: Look for a section titled "PC Board Layout," "Land Pattern Design," or "Packaging Information." This provides the recommended footprint.
Beware of "Nominal" Values: Some datasheets show idealistic dimensions. Cross-reference the recommended footprint with the component's actual measurements.
Use Library Tools with Caution: While EDA library tools are helpful, always double-check their output against the manufacturer's latest datasheet.
2. Master the Solder Pad Geometry
The solder pads are the most critical part of the footprint.
Pad Size is Key: Pads must be large enough to form a reliable solder joint but not so large that they cause bridging. A good rule of thumb is to extend the pad beyond the component's terminal by a small margin (e.g., 0.2mm - 0.5mm for chip components).
The Goldilocks Zone for Solder Mask: The solder mask opening (SMD) must be slightly larger than the copper pad. This prevents the mask from spilling onto the pad, which would hinder soldering, while still providing a sufficient barrier to prevent solder bridging.
3. Don't Forget the Human Touch: Silkscreen & Polarity
A clear silkscreen is vital for assembly, debugging, and rework.
Clear Outline: Draw a clear outline of the component body. This helps our operators visually verify correct placement and orientation.
Polarity Markings: For diodes, capacitors, and ICs, always include an unambiguous polarity indicator (e.g., "+", a band for diodes, a dot for pin 1). This is a simple step that prevents catastrophic assembly errors.
4. Design for the Real World: Assembly & Inspection
Think beyond the CAD screen to how the board will be built and checked.
Adequate Spacing: Ensure there is sufficient space between components for the soldering iron tip or rework nozzle during potential repairs.
Inspection Access: For BGAs or other hidden solder joints, consider adding side-view access for automated optical inspection (AOI) or space for X-Ray inspection.
5. The Golden Rule: Create a Physical Sample
This is the most reliable verification step.
Print and Check: Before finalizing your design, print your PCB layout at a 1:1 scale on a sheet of paper.
Place the Component: Take a real component and place it directly onto the printed paper footprint. This instantly reveals any errors in size, spacing, or orientation.
